Pugh Wins it for Hungerford

In the Evo-Stik League Southern Division One South & West`s opening day fixtures, fancied Hungerford Town came....

0 Comments

Published 19th August 2012

Pugh Wins it for Hungerford
Ben Pugh

....back from a goal down to win 2-1 at Bridgwater Town with a goal 4 minutes from time.

Ross McNab gave the home side a 22nd minute lead that Luke Hopper cancelled out 8 minutes later.

And it was summer signing Ben Pugh who won it for the visitors late on.

Cinderford Town, two ahead at the break through Lewis Sommers and Lee Smith, completed a 3-1 home win over Paulton Rovers with a third from Matt Smith after Scott Brice had pulled Rovers back into the game after 58 minutes.

Didcot Town scored a goal in each half from Lance and Morgan Williams to defeat visiting Yate Town 2-0, while Evesham United scored on the stroke of half-time through Marcus Palmer to record a 1-0 victory over Sholing to make it a winning start in their new stadium.

Cirencester Town scored 3 minutes before the break through James Reid to win 1-0 at Mangotsfield United, and Bishops Cleeve, a Carl Brown goal ahead after 8 minutes, won 3-1 at North Leigh with further strikes from Lamin Sankoh and Stuart Midwinter.

Fancied Poole Town scored a goal in each half through Marvin Brookes to record a 2-0 home win over Clevedon Town, while newly-promoted Winchester City made a winning start with a 3-2 home victory against Taunton Town with four of the goals coming in the final 10 minutes from Michael Charles and Tom Dunford for City and a Rodney Marsh brace for the Peacocks after Leigh Mills had given the home side a 37th minutes lead.

Another of the newcomers, Shortwood United, took a point from a 2-2 home draw with Wimborne Town and another, Merthyr Town, were two ahead midway through the second half from Russell Jones and Andrew Thomas, but also had to settle for a point when hosts Swindon Supermarine made it 2-2 with 5 minutes remaining, courtesy of Ashley Edenborough`s second of the game.

The game between Tiverton Town and Abingdon United finished goalless at Ladysmead.
